JS实现快排算法
摘要:快速排序的思想很简单,整个排序过程只需要三步:
1. 在数据集中,选择一个元素作为“基准”(pivot)
2. 所有小于“基准”的元素,都移到“基准”的左边,所有大于“基准”的元素,都移到右边。
3. 对“基准”左边和右边的两个子集,不断重复第一步和第二步,直到所有子集只剩下一个元素为止。
阅读全文
posted @
2013-02-27 20:47
mackxu
阅读(3957)
推荐(0)
JS获取DOM元素位置与大小
摘要:offsetHeight,offsetWidth,offsetLeft, offsetTop,clientWidth, clientHeight,innerWidth,innerHeight,scrollHeight, scrollWidth, scrollLeft, scrollTop之间的区别
阅读全文
posted @
2012-12-29 22:57
mackxu
阅读(4893)
推荐(0)
JS字符串操作总结
摘要:属性:length
方法: match() search()
replace() slice() [汉]菜刀,切开
substring() substr() split() [汉]分离
indexOf() lastIndexOf()
charAt() charCodeAt()
fromCharCode()
阅读全文
posted @
2012-12-29 21:40
mackxu
阅读(259)
推荐(0)
定时器让出时间片段
摘要:定时器与UI线程的交互方式有助于把长时间运行脚本拆分成为较短的片段。
阅读全文
posted @
2012-12-21 15:16
mackxu
阅读(442)
推荐(0)
AJAX数据传输之请求与发送
摘要:XHR、动态脚本注入、图片信标、MXHR数据请求发送
阅读全文
posted @
2012-12-21 09:25
mackxu
阅读(841)
推荐(0)
JS浏览器UI线程
摘要:共用于执行JavaScript代码和更新用户界面的进程通常称为”浏览器UI线程”;
阅读全文
posted @
2012-12-06 22:16
mackxu
阅读(1723)
推荐(1)
jQuery.ready和onload区别
摘要:转载:http://www.cnblogs.com/gossip/archive/2012/03/12/2392463.html
阅读全文
posted @
2012-12-02 15:14
mackxu
阅读(923)
推荐(0)
JS匿名函数
摘要:JS匿名函数、闭包、私有变量、模仿块级作用域、模块模式
阅读全文
posted @
2012-11-19 12:16
mackxu
阅读(573)
推荐(1)